Learning basic chemical principles, techniques for calculating basic kinetic parameters related to reaction rate, gaining the ability to evaluate chemical reaction processes with different thermodynamic functions
Basic concepts of chemical kinetics, the reaction rate, order, mechanisim, molecularity, activation energy, evaluation of kinetic data, theoretical determination of the rate of the reaction, gas phase reactions, reactions in solution, collision theory, catalysis, homogeneous and heterogeneous catalysis, complex reactions, informing of students about the polymerization reaction kinetics
| 1. | Defines basic concepts in chemical kinetics |
| 2. | Defines reaction rate, degree, mechanism and molecularity. |
| 3. | Explains activation energy |
| 4. | Evaluates and uses kinetic data |
| 5. | Calculates the reaction rate theoretically |
| 6. | Explains solution reactions |
| 7. | Defines catalysis and gives examples of homogeneous and heterogeneous catalysis |
| 8. | Explain the polymerization reaction kinetics |
